Orion Pictures signs lyricist Sameer for five films

Businessofcinema.com Team

MUMBAI: Mukesh Talreja and Nikhil Advani's Orion Pictures has signed lyricist Sameer to pen the lyrics for the production house's five upcoming films.

As has already been reported by Businessofcinema.com, Orion Pictures is planning to produce six films over the next 12 months. Of the two films that are under production are Chandni Chowk to China and Ab Dilli Door Nahi. Another film in the offing is the official remake of Hollywood movie Wedding Crashers.

Chandni Chowk to China stars Akshay Kumar and Deepika Padukone and is being distributed by Warner Bros.

Orion Pictures has commissioned four other projects one of which is Milap Milan Zaveri's Jaane Kahan Se Aayi Hai, which stars Ritiesh Deshmukh and Ayesha Takia. The other films, which are in the pipeline will be directed by Nikhil Advani, Vikramiditya Motwane and Shivam Nair.
